Assistant Chef salary at Indian Oil Corporation ranges between ₹18 Lakhs to ₹23 Lakhs per year for employees with 3 years of experience. Salary estimates are based on 1 latest salaries received from various employees of Indian Oil Corporation.

Dislikes

The pay discrimination. Since its a PSU, one of the biggest disadvantages is that you are not paid according to your Qualification and contribution rather it is much based on how long have you been in the company. The organization has been filled with enough examples where an IITian, CAs, MBA professionals who are much important to organization because of their skills are being paid less than an old age employees who might be just doing basic work like passing of medical invoices, being PAs to senior management, employee reimbursement review etc. They work does not contribute either to the growth or profitability of the organization however there CTC 3-4 times higher than that of Qualified personnel working in the same company. Further, very limited personnel from the top management are actually concerned about the health of the organization but mostly are just there to complete their tenure which makes the organization extremely slow and difficult for young professionals to work with full efficiency.
